Hyperbaric oxygen therapy (HBOT) is a therapeutic intervention where patients inhale pure oxygen in a pressurized chamber. This heightened pressure, typically 2-3 times atmospheric pressure, enables an exponential increase in oxygen absorption by the bloodstream. The augmented oxygen levels expedite cellular repair, ameliorate blood circulation, and bolster the immune response. Originally devised to treat decompression sickness in divers, HBOT has since transcended to address a myriad of ailments, including chronic wounds, carbon monoxide poisoning, and certain infections. Autism, or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D), is a neurodevelopmental condition characterized by challenges in social interaction, communication, and repetitive behaviors. Symptoms can vary widely, ranging from mild to severe, and often appear in early childhood, typically before the age of three. Individuals with autism may have difficulty understanding social cues, maintaining eye contact, and engaging in typical conversational exchanges. They might also exhibit repetitive behaviors such as hand-flapping, strict adherence to routines, or intense focus on specific interests. ASD affects people of all racial, ethnic, and socioeconomic backgrounds, with a higher prevalence in males compared to females. Early intervention and tailored support are crucial for improving outcomes. Treatments often include behavioral therapy, speech therapy, and occupational therapy, designed to enhance communication skills, social interactions, and daily functioning. Understanding and acceptance of autism are vital in supporting individuals on the spectrum, allowing them to lead fulfilling and productive lives.
